Concrete Foundation Repair in Tampa, FL
Concrete fo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These services typically cover a range of projects, including stabilizing settling foundations, repairing cracks, addressing shifting or sinking sections, and restoring structural support for residential properties such as homes, garages, and basements. Property owners usually seek these repairs when noticing signs like uneven floors, visible cracks in walls or the foundation, or doors and windows that no longer open properly, as these can indicate underlying foundation problems that require professional attention.
Before requesting foundation repair services, property owners should understand the specific signs of foundation issues and the potential causes, such as soil movement or moisture changes. It is important to assess the extent of damage and determine whether repairs are necessary to prevent further structural deterioration. Clear communication about the property's history, current condition, and any previous repairs can help in planning an effective solution. Proper evaluation ensures that the repair process addresses the root causes and supports the long-term stability of the property.

Common Concrete Foundation Repair Jobs
Basement Foundation Repair - stabilizes and restores the structural integrity of basement foundations.
Slab Foundation Repair - addresses cracks and unevenness in concrete slabs to prevent further damage.
Pier and Beam Repair - reinforces or replaces supports to prevent settling and shifting.
Crack Repair - seals and reinforces cracks to maintain stability and prevent water intrusion.
Water Damage Repair - mitigates issues caused by water infiltration that can weaken foundations.
Settlement Repair - corrects uneven settling to prevent future structural problems.
Concrete Foundation Repair Questions
What causes foundation damage in Tampa homes? Foundation damage can result from soil movement, moisture changes, and poor drainage around the property.
How can I tell if my foundation need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and gaps between walls and floors.
What types of foundation repair services are available? Services may include underpinning, slab lifting, crack sealing, and drainage improvements to stabilize the foundation.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require repair, but larger or expanding cracks should be evaluated to prevent further issues.
